accumulate sats as much as you can as fast as you can. Is 2025 not 2010 anymore... stop spending money on crap things. BUY sats instead. Spend only minimum. Here you have a list and you can start by selling all kind of things you do not need for more sats on P2P marketplaces. You cannot live on Bitcoin without having a decent amount of it.
learn more about how to use Bitcoin, every fucking day read something new about. There's plenty of free documentation and guides out there. Knowledge is power. For more you will know, less you can be scammed and fooled.
start testing apps, running nodes, practice and get comfortable with apps and transacting with BTC. Don't worry that you will fail. Failure is the best teacher
became a toxic maxi and your path will be successful
slowly start onboarding merchants around you, once you are comfortable with teaching others, small steps and climb the slowly the ladder on more complicated solutions.
start looking for a job that pays in bitcoin, or use bitwage (here is a guide). The key to live on bitcoin is to EARN sats and not have to buy anymore sats. YOU CANNOT LIVE ON BITCOIN WITHOUT EARNING IT.
start creating a Bitcoin Circular Economy around you, in your local community. You cannot live on bitcoin if your sats do not circulate and later comes back to you or others.
